Finding effective storage solutions for handbags in a limited area can be challenging, but one of the best strategies is to utilize vertical space. Instead of letting your bags pile up, think about installing some wall-mounted shelves. You can display your favorite handbags on these shelves, creating a visually appealing feature while keeping them organized. Use stylish hooks or decorative brackets to hold your bags in place, ensuring they’re not just stored, but showcased too. This technique doesn’t just save floor space, it also makes the bags easily accessible. You might consider adding a small stool or ladder to reach higher shelves without straining your back.
Choose Multi-Functional Furniture
When adapting your living area for better handbag storage, selecting multi-functional furniture can work wonders. For instance, a storage bench or ottoman can serve as an attractive accent piece while housing your collection of handbags inside. These types of furniture often blend seamlessly into your decor, keeping your handbags out of sight but within easy reach. If you’re feeling creative, consider upcycling an old dresser or cabinet, giving it a second life as both a storage unit for handbags and a stylish addition to your home. This way, you maintain a clean and organized look without sacrificing your unique style.
Use Clear Storage Bins
Utilizing clear storage containers can turn your handbag dilemma into a manageable situation. By placing your bags into these bins, not only do you keep them dust-free, but you also make it incredibly easy to see your options at a glance. Stackable clear bins work particularly well in closets, and some even come with labels to identify what’s inside. Opt for a range of sizes, accommodating everything from small clutches to larger tote bags. This organizational method also encourages you to rotate your handbag usage, making it less likely for any piece to be neglected and thereby giving your collection a fresh perspective regularly.

Utilize Drawer Space Efficiently
If you’re lucky enough to have some drawer space available, don’t let it go to waste. Using dividers can help keep your handbags aligned and organized, preventing them from getting lost or tangled with one another. If drawer depth allows, lying larger bags flat can keep them in great condition, while smaller bags can be stored upright. Consider using separator boards to create individual compartments, easily keeping similar items together. This solution ensures that your bags are hidden from dust and debris, while also allowing you to store other accessories such as scarves and wallets nearby.

Keep Seasonal Bags in Storage
If you’re really pressed for space, consider packing away seasonal bags that you’re not currently using. Using dust bags or wrapping them in soft materials can protect them during storage. This technique not only frees up valuable space but also helps maintain the integrity of the bags over time. When off-season, store these bags in a climate-controlled area if possible, away from direct sunlight and moisture. Keeping your current rotation smaller allows you to enjoy the bags you’re using, and you’ll always be excited to unpack those special seasonal pieces when the time comes around.
